Did you know Anderson ranks ninth among wide receivers in yards, right behind Keenan Allen? The one touchdown he's scored has left fantasy managers feeling empty, especially knowing it came all the way back in Week 1. Can he get back into the end zone against the Vikings? They've allowed 17 wide receiver touchdowns this season, while there's just one other team who's allowed more than 14 of them. They've allowed a touchdown every 12.1 targets to wide receivers, which is the second-most often. This is great news for the receiver who's averaged 8.6 targets per game. He's likely going to see a lot of rookie Cameron Dantzler in coverage, who's been burned in coverage, allowing 29-of-40 passing for 331 yards and four touchdowns in his coverage. He just returned from a serious injury last week and played just 20 snaps, so he's still getting back into form. Anderson should be in lineups as a mid-to-low-end WR2 who should have a good shot to score.
